Kathmandu [Nepal], February 12 (ANI): Nepal government on Sunday declared a public holiday for Monday to mark the Maoist War anniversary.
Nepal’s Maoist Center-led government of Pushpa Kamal Dahal made the decision for the first time in Nepal’s history to declare a public holiday. The decade-long insurgency began in 1996 and claimed thousands of lives with scores still missing till date.
